    Sam Harris is an American author and atheist. He has written several atheist advocacy books, including The End of Faith (2004) and Letter to a Christian Nation. In 2009, Harris was awarded a Ph.D. degree in cognitive neuroscience from the University of California, Los Angeles. He is an author in the new atheism movement.

    Sam Harris' Arguments against Religion

    Sam Harris considers religion's harmful qualities, such as terrorism, territorial claims and sexual anxiety, outweigh its positive aspects. "Can anyone seriously argue that it is a good thing that millions of Muslims currently believe in the metaphysics of martyrdom?" Religious believers give "tacit support to the religious differences in our world."
    Harris argues that even if religion provides morality or gives our lives meaning does not automatically imply the existence of God.

    He suggests that since it is impossible to coexist with Islamic states given the existence of disruptive technology, therefore there is no option by economic and military intervention to depose theocracies and impose western civil society or at least benign dictatorship around the world:

    "It appears that one of the most urgent tasks we now face in the developed world is to find some way of facilitating the emergence of civil societies everywhere else. [... Where this is not possible, it] seems all but certain that some form of benign dictatorship will generally be necessary to bridge the gap. But benignity is the key– and if it cannot emerge from within a state, it must be imposed from without. The means of such imposition are necessarily crude: they amount to economic isolation, military intervention (whether open or covert), or some combination of both. While this may seem an exceedingly arrogant doctrine to espouse, it appears we have no alternatives. We cannot wait for weapons of mass destruction to dribble out of the former Soviet Union to pick only one horrible possibility and into the hands of fanatics."

    Harris argues that not all religions are equally harmful. He is particularly critical of Islam and commented that "We have to be able to criticize bad ideas, and Islam is the Mother lode of bad ideas." In explaining this statement, he said: "I think that we have an idea here that all of the religious are the same, that they are all equality wise, or equally empty or equally irrelevant. And obviously devout believers of various religions don't believe this but secular liberals believe this and it's just not true. Our religions are quite different and there are many cases in which Christianity is worse than Islam, if you are going to talk about something like opposition to embryonic stem cell research. [...] We have to acknowledge that Islam has doctrines like jihād and martyrdom and death to apostates which are central to the faith in which they aren't in other faiths."

    — CNN, Harris: Islam is "mother lode" of bad ideas, 13 Oct 2014
